June 11, 1984: Tigers 5 – Blue Jays 4
W: Dave Rozema (2-0) – L: Luis Leal (6-1) – S: Willie Hernández (10) | Boxscore
Record: 44-14 — 8 games up on Toronto
Highlights

- Detroit knocked around Leal with nine hits in six innings: three doubles, a triple and a Kirk Gibson home run.
- Rozema went five, allowing three runs on four hits. Newcomer Sid Monge was immediately pressed into duty; he faced one batter, threw two pitches and gave up a single.
- Willy pitched 21/3 scoreless, yielding a hit and striking out three.
